Angelo Petraglia is a musician and high school philosophy teacher. Born in Lodi in 1989, he began studying piano at the age of 8, and since his childhood improvisation has been his privileged way of musical expression. After graduating in Philosophical Sciences with full marks and honors in Milan, he moved to Siena to further his musical studies at Siena Jazz and Accademia Chigiana. From 2016 to 2018 he attended the Permanent Musical Research Workshops for Pianists led by Stefano Battaglia. His first piano solo work, Di Stanze, miniature, recorded in 2018, will emerge from this formative experience. The record, which includes 15 short improvisations, is largely inspired by poetry and in particular by the lyrics of young Milanese poet Davide Romagnoli (Di Stanze/miniature, Crema Culture, 2021).

Currently, in addition to performing solo, he has an improvisation duo with percussionist Giuseppe Sardina (half asleep, Setola di maiale 2023), together with singer Clizia Miglianti, “Visions”, a project that pays tribute to the great English poet William Blake.
